Clearly a great filter.

I use this filter with my Nikon D3X lenses, primarily for protection, as I trudge through forests and city excursions. It is thin and crystal clear. The threaded front allows me to add N.D. or I.R. filers, as well. If you have invested a lot of cash in your glass, you have to couple it with the best optical protection. This filter gives me the protection I need with flexibility and no noticeable interference.

Use this UV filter or nothing at all

If you're going to use a UV filter to protect your lens then you MUST use the best. A $20 filter from [...] will do nothing but make your pictures look soft and flat.My only real complaint is that I've had a real problem getting this screwed on to ONE of my lenses. My 24-105, which previously had a Hoya Pro1 UV filter and no install/removal issues, is a fight every time I need to add or remove this filter. My 10-22 & 24mm f/1.4L II are both trouble-free. This is more of a lens issue than a filter one, but I can tell you that with as thin as this filter is, it's not helping the ease of install...

About B + W 77mm XS-Pro UV Haze MRC 010M Filter

This UV Filter blocks the invisible UV component of light from the sky, which can cause blur and to which many color films react with a blue cast. These filters should be called UV-Blocking Filters, because there are filters for technical applications that pass UV radiation and block all the other wavelengths.

Nevertheless, the short term "UV Filter" has become established among photographers. UV Filters are ideal for photography in high altitudes (in the mountains), by the sea and in regions with very clean air.

The pictures gain brilliance and disturbing blue casts are avoided. Because the glass is colorless, color rendition is not altered, aside from the elimination of the unwanted blue cast, and no increase in exposure is required.

That makes a UV Filter very suitable as protection of the front element of the taking lens against dust, flying sand, sea water spray and the like, and it can be kept on the lens at all times. It is recommended for analog color and black-and-white as well as digital photography.

This filter uses B&W's XS-Pro Digital mount which is especially suited for DSLRs with wide angle and zoom lenses. It has a front thread for additional accessories such as lens caps or hoods. All XS-PRO Digital mounts are made of brass and are matte black to prevent reflections.

MRC (Multi-Resistant Coating) by B+W is not only an extraordinarily effective multiple layer coating, it is also harder than glass, so that it protects filters from scratches (for instance when cleaning the filters), and it is also water and dirt repellent, thus facilitating filter maintenance.
